Re: Muslim in Japan 2019/9/18 15:48
How about the cooking appliances? should i buy it? in case the appliances used to cook pig or alcohol. Thank you.
by Thia (guest) rate this post as useful

Re: Muslim in Japan 2019/9/18 16:10
If you are really concern about non-halal contamination of cooking utensils and stuff,
it is your best interest to buy and use your own. Keep your stuff separately from others.

Sharehouse is shared by people from all walks of life, religion/cultural, so expect common things in the house are shared by others.
